Orion's Story

Orion (aka Gentle Giant, Hunk of Love, Big Mush) is as sweet as they come! This big boy doesn’t realize his size and if you're on the floor, your lap is fair game! Despite his robust 90lbs of love, he thinks he is a lap dog and you can't tell him otherwise! <br/><br/>Sadly, after spending nearly his entire life with a family, he pulled the short straw in a divorce and ended up in rescue due to a lack of time available for him. <br/><br/>Orion has all the basics under his belt. He is house and crate trained but questions the real need for a crate as it is not his favorite place to be! Leash walks are a breeze, but don't expect him to complete half marathons...he has a couch and a nap to get back to! He is well aware and will make it known he was built for looks, NOT for speed! Orion has basic obedience and is well mannered. He doesn't even attempt to jump on the bed at night(maybe due to his size inhibiting him?); he is perfectly content sleeping on the floor near by! <br/><br/>Orion is thoroughly enjoying his time with the kids and canine companions in his foster home! His previous owner mentioned he was friendly around cats. After his (short spurt of) morning zoomies with his canine friends, he leisurely takes on the rest of his day with a nap or two. Outings are a highlight to his day, though! He is always up for a trip to a kid's baseball game or practice. He quickly has learned this guarantees attention and lovin'. This guy has quickly taken to being the center of attention and has no regrets! He happily will soak up all the attention he can get!<br/><br/>Orion is being fostered in Jacksonville, FL.
